  • Title

    Highly efficient integrated voice and data packet access for next generation mobile systems

  • Abstract
    This paper proposes a highly efficient integrated voice and data packet access on downlink for the next generation multimedia mobile communication systems. The proposed method is made by the combination of two approaches: namely (1) TDMA with a dynamic slot assignment; and (2) CDMA with an adaptive spreading factor control. The proposed integrated voice and data packet access method is compared with two alternative methods and the results show that the proposed method achieves high rate downlink data transmission without disturbing voice transmission.
